In this video, Ben from Front Range Fishing reviews the Redington Path rod and Crosswater reel combo. He purchased this combo on a whim with gift cards and found it to be a great deal. The rod is a four-piece design, making it easy to pack and comes with a durable case. The Crosswater reel is the base model and while it is functional, Ben plans to upgrade it in the future. The line provided with the combo was initially a bit stiff but stretched out nicely after a few hours of use. Overall, Ben highly recommends the Path rod for its smooth casting and durable construction, and suggests Redington gear for entry-level to intermediate fly fishermen.
